Veteran journalist David Corn—Washington Bureau Chief for Mother Jones magazine and New York Times bestselling author of Hubris (with Michael Isikoff) and The Lies of George W. Bush—now brings us Showdown, the dramatic inside story of Barack Obama’s fight to save his presidency. With Bob Woodward-esque insight and narrative flair, Corn takes readers into the White House and behind the political scenes during the beleaguered president’s pivotal third year, and explores the most earth-shaking events of the Obama presidency—from the game changing 2010 elections to the Arab Spring, the debt ceiling battle with Congressional Republicans, the killing of Osama bin Laden and beyond.

David Corn is the Washington bureau chief for Mother Jones magazine and an analyst for MSNBC and NBC News. He is the author of the New York Times bestsellers Hubris (with Michael Isikoff) and The Lies of George W. Bush, and regularly provides commentary on National Public Radio.

Includes Introduction: Bending the Arc; Also includes chapters on Before the Shellacking; The Deal That Worked; A Complete Win; A Quiet Victory; The Strategy; Leaning Foreword; The Battle Begins; Leading from Behind the Scenes; The End of the Beginning; Mission Accomplished; Return of the Hostage Takers; The Big Cross; Obama Unleashed; and The Battle Ahead. Also includes Acknowledgments, A Note on Sources, and Index. In Showdown, political journalist David Corn chronicles and examines this crucial time in the Obama presidency and its impact on the nation's future. Drawing on interviews with White House officials, Obama's inner circle, members of Congress, and others, Corn takes the reader into the Oval office and the back rooms on Capitol Hill for a fast paced and gripping account.
